Yoga: It’s More than You Think
At the Simms/Mann Health and Wellness Center of Venice Family Clinic, 2509 Pico Blvd, Santa Monica
Taught by Veronica Zador E-RYT-500
In this workshop, participants will learn to move through resistance with the least amount of conflict. Through a process of self-inquiry, participants will be guided in their practice of yoga postures with a focus on safety. Easily implementable alternatives will be offered when appropriate. In addition, participants will experience the usefulness of yogic breathing and the quality of stillness. The group will discuss how ancient yogic texts inform what and why things are done so that each participant can integrate principles that are useful in their yoga practices and daily lives.
The combined components of the workshop will help enable participants to deepen the meaning of their current practice, to identify yoga practices and teachers that best suit their needs, and to heighten their own sense of balance between physicality, breath and overall well-being.
This program is for yoga students of all levels.
This is a two-part program; concepts from the first session will be explored in greater depth in the second one. CEUs are available for RNs.
